Car Audio Subwoofer Basics

Typical car audio systems have small speakers with limited ability to reproduce low-frequency sounds. Car audio subwoofers can add more depth to a car audio system by reproducing frequencies below 150 hertz. A subwoofer can add strong and powerful basses to your car audio.

Most car audio subwoofers are installed in the trunk due to space limitations in the cabin of the car. Subwoofers are usually 10 inches or 12 inches in diameter although they can be as big as 34 inches and as small as 4 inches.

Wider subwoofers allow for more efficient air displacement which is critical for low frequencies.

The amplifier for car audio subwoofers can be integrated into the cabinet or installed as a separate unit. The amplifier should have an electronic crossover to filter out high-frequency sounds before the signal is passed to the subwoofer.

Although car audio subwoofers are usually round in shape, recently manufactures have been introducing subwoofers in new shapes. Square subwoofers have been released by Stillwater Designs and other companies have introduced triangular and hexagonal subwoofers. These innovative designs may be easier to install in cars with limited space, but there is no acoustical advantage to nonround shapes.

The type of enclosure for car audio subwoofers influences the kind of sound that is produced.

There are five basic types of subwoofer enclosures -

* sealed,

* ported,

* bandpass,

* passive radiator and

* transmission line systems.

For car use, the most practical type of enclosure is the sealed enclosure because it requires the minimum space and matches the audio requirements of a typical car interior.

There are many premade enclosures for car audio subwoofers on the market. Alternatively, you can have one custom-made or build one yourself. When you buy a subwoofer driver, you will usually receive a spec sheet which gives you guidelines for enclosure requirements. Also check out the spec sheets for power requirements and linear response - a flat response will give the truest sound.

Many people are tempted to crank up the sound when they have car audio subwoofers installed. Although it sounds great, take care - prolonged exposure to loud sounds can permanently affect your hearing.

Car Insurance Premiums Suffer From Whiplash

It has been described by the Association of British Insurers as an epidemic - and now new research from the AA shows the true cost of mounting numbers of whiplash personal injury claims.

According to the report, 1,200 people claim for whiplash injuries every day in the UK - an increase of 25 per cent over the last five years. In 2007, there were 430,000 people claiming on their car insurance for whiplash injuries which cost the industry a cool 1.9 billion in compensation.

Unfortunately for car insurance customers, the companies have to get the money to pay for these claims from somewhere - and AA Insurance estimates that whiplash claims hike every car insurance policy in the UK by around 66. This is more than twice the cost of claims for accidents with uninsured drivers.

Whiplash is likely to become an increasingly important factor in future premium increases - already over the last year the average quoted shop-around car insurance premium has leapt by 8.7 per cent. So how can drivers protect themselves and avoid placing further pressure on their premiums?

The first step of course, is to avoid accidents altogether. While you can't always prepare for the actions of others, you can reduce your risk by insuring your vehicle is well-maintained and that you drive within the road rules. Stick to speed limits and leave suitable stopping distances between your car and the vehicle in front - two seconds normally, but double this in icy or wet conditions.

If an accident does occur you could avoid whiplash if you have adjusted your head restraints before driving. The top of the head restraint should be level with the top of the driver's head and it should never be lower than eye level.

Remember that any claim on your car insurance will wipe out a no-claims bonus and bump up your premiums. The only exception is if you take out no-claims discount protection - compare car insurance with a comparison website to find insurers that offer this feature.

Important Car Theft Prevention

Most people will have experienced or know someone who has experienced some sort of car theft, whether it be a car break-in resulting in loss of expensive items or the car itself being stolen. All car owners must do all they can to help secure their cars so that it is either very difficult for a thief to break into a car or so your security measures act as a deterrent to the thief from even attempting to steal from your car. Vehicle crime currently stands at around 1.7 million per year, which the authorities claim is down from previous years. The biggest motivation for a person to do all they can to secure their vehicle is that most people use their car every day and really cannot do without it, also they are expensive things to retrieve and repair if they have been damaged in a crime related incident. In this article you will find many hints and tips which should be adhered to by all drivers in order to secure your vehicle and possessions.

The first thing to do is keep all valuables such as satellite navigation systems, loose change, CD radio fascias, mobile phones and laptops out of view, either underneath covers, underneath seats or in a looked boot, if people can't see anything of real value in the car, chances are they will not have a reason to break into your car. Thieves are attracted to these kinds of items because they are small so easy to steal and easy to sell on. Whatever you do don't make it easy for the average thief to enter your car, make sure all doors are securely locked, the boot is locked and that all windows are fully close, even the slightest gap could enable a person to insert an instrument and open your window.

Most modern cars come with an alarm and immobiliser fitted as standard, if your car does not have these features, it could be worthwhile investing in them. An alarm can act as a great deterrent and attract unwanted attention towards the thief. An immobiliser basically stops the car from starting its engine unless the correct code is entered. Make sure you have a sticker which you can place on the window which highlights the safety features installed on your car, this acts as a great deterrent. Having these safety features can have other benefits such as brining down the price of your insurance because there is a less likelihood of your car being broken into. There are also further simple measures you can take such as purchasing a steering wheel lock and wheel locking nuts to stop your expensive alloy wheels from being stolen.

The future looks very bright for car security measures, already there are cars being developed which incorporate biometric technology such as finger print recognition and iris recognition as an anti-theft measure, basically it works by only letting verified drivers start the car. Also there is technology already in circulation which lets you know via SMS text messaging if your car is being broken into. There is no doubt that these technologies and more will be introduced into the mass market in order to stamp out crime waves of car thefts.

Car Heater Not Working - Blowing Cold Air!

There are several reasons why your car's heater may be blowing cold air, instead of heat. It is important to understand how the heater works in your car before you can begin to try to diagnose why it is not working. First, there is NOT anelectricheater element in the heater system in automobiles, like in portable heaters used in the home. The part that transfers heat into the passenger compartment is called a heater core.A heater core can be thought of as a miniature radiator. The car engine's coolant flows through the heater core while the fan (also calleda blower), blows airthrough the heater core fins. Whenair blows through the heater core fins,it is warmed, therefore warming the passenger compartment.

Start by checking the coolant. As we already said coolant is what warms the heater core. So if the coolant is low, there may not be a sufficient amount of warmth to transfer heat to the air in the passenger compartment.Since it 's cold outside, low coolant may not effect the operating temperature of the engine significantly, so you won't be alerted to a coolant problem by the temperature gage on the instrument panel. Once the coolant is full, feel the heater hoses that go through the firewall. With the engine at normal operating temperature,BOTH of the heaterhoses should be hot to the touch. If only one is hot, this indicates there is is a blockage in the heater core or there is air trapped in theheater core. Using a Lisle coolantfunnel is helpful in purging the air from the cooling system. Ifthe coolant is really brown, has been neglected, orif "stop leak" has been used at somepoint,the heater core could be stopped up. The blockage can sometimes be unstoppedby removing the heater hoses and using agarden hose with a sprayer to flush the heater coreout. If neither of the hoses are hot to the touch, there could also be a malfunctioning heater control valve, if used on the model you're working on. Check for presence of a heater control valve by following the heater hoses back to the engine. Sometimes, a vacuum line could have a break causing there to be no vacuum to operate the valve. Also it should be noted that if this is your first winter with this car (andyou're unfamiliar with the car's repair history),the previous owner could have by-passed the heater core because of a leak. When a heater core leaks, usually they wet the passenger side floorboard. The labor cost to change heater coresis usually expensive, so sometimes people will loopthe heater hosesand by-passa leaking heater core instead of repairing it properly.

Next check for proper airflow.After you're sure the heater core is getting hot water flow, read the following information. Doors withinthe heater case are either controlled by electric actuators, cables or vacuum motors. Adjust the heat controlto both extremes whilelistening for movement of the blend door. With a cable operatedheater door it's easiest tohear the door thump when it closes.If the dooris not operating, find the door thatcontrols the airflowacross the heater core. Ifthere isan electric motor that controls the door, tapping on it can sometimes make it work temporarily for testing purposes.A vacuum operated motor needs vacuum to work, so using ahandheld vacuum pump for testing is usually recommended. If the vacuummotor does not hold vacuum, the diaphragm is leaking requiringreplacement. To go deeper into diagnoses of the control head's function and diagnosis, specific vehiclerepair manual information is needed.But hopefully the basics laid outin this article has helped toget you started on the right track.

Car Rental Insurance

Wherever in the world you are planning to hire a car, you can be certain that the cost of car rental insurance will be at least as much as the hire of the vehicle itself. The insurance is vital, of course, to indemnify the hirer not only against third party liabilities but other damage to the vehicle or its theft, resulting in the loss of its use. With the car rental insurance bill absorbing such a high proportion of the cost, therefore, it is good news to discover that those costs can be considerably reduced - by as much as a half - by arranging all the necessary insurance separately, in advance, whether the proposed rental will be in the UK or elsewhere in the world.

Taking advantage of such cost reductions is simply a question of buying all the necessary insurance cover in advance from a company specialising in this area. Separating the two forms of business in this way allows the customer to concentrate on the car rental firm for doing what it does best - renting cars - and leaving the car rental insurance to the experts in the field of motor insurance.

For example, whether the car hire is being arranged in the UK, Europe or North America, the quoted rate is likely to include a relatively large proportion to cover third party liabilities and accidental damage to the vehicle (generally termed a Collision Damage Waiver) and theft. In most parts of the world (with the exception of the United States), the Collision Damage Waiver will include an excess, which is the uninsured element of any accidental damage to the vehicle and which therefore remains the responsibility of the hirer him or herself.

If an excess is to be applied, this should be made clear by the rental company, together with the level of risk to be borne by the hirer. This is important, since it represents the first part to be paid against any damage incurred and is typically as much as 600 - and in some instances can be as high as 1,000. In order to mitigate such personal risk on the part of the hirer, the rental company will generally offer an optional excess insurance policy to cover the whole or part of the excess. In this way, it would be possible to reduce the hirer's personal liability from the standard 600, for example, to 100 or even to nil.

A more cost-effective way of insuring this excess - and indeed the whole of the car rental insurance - however, can be secured by buying the cover entirely separately from the rental agreement. Specialist, independent insurance providers can arrange the whole of the cover required, either on a single-hire basis or on an annual basis, to cover multiple rental agreements throughout the year. Such cover tends to be considerably cheaper - up to 50% less - than that arranged by the rental company, yet can provide even more extensive protection than the rental company's insurance.

Typical areas of car rental insurance cover, for example, include full Collision Damage Waiver (providing protection against loss, damage, theft or loss of use of the hire car); Supplemental Liability Insurance (extending third party liability limits up to a typical US$1 million - and certainly to be recommended if the rental agreement is for a car in the United States or Canada; cover for damage to the rental vehicle's roof, underside, types and windows (usually excluded from the Collision Damage Waiver); compensation for accidents involving uninsured or hit-and-run third parties; cover for lost keys; and cover for any further excess on the hire car.

Winter Car Maintenance

Careful attention to your winter car maintenance can help to ensure that your vehicle does what you want it to, when you want it to, whatever freezing temperatures the winter brings or stormy weather conditions. A well-maintained car is a lot less likely to let you down and leave you in the grip of a cold and icy emergency or breakdown.

Tyres

A regular spot of winter car maintenance should take in the tyres, not only for their depth of tread, but just as importantly, their correct pressure. Too low, and they'll wear out more quickly and need the engine to consume more fuel; too high and you could lose the grip that they give on icy roads.

Battery

Obviously, the battery is critical to getting you started, yet an old and weakened battery can lose as much as one third of its power in icy conditions, leaving you in danger of being unable to start the car or taking much longer to do so.

Lubrication

As the cold weather persists it could well be worth considering changing the engine oil to one with a lower than normal viscosity. Such "thinner" oil will help the car start more easily but can also help to reduce friction and wear by getting more quickly to the areas of the engine that need the lubrication.

Wipers

Snow, rain, ice and general dirt from the road can soon wear down the rubber of the wiper blades, so it's worth checking whether they still do a good job. Clear visibility through the window is even more important in hazardous road conditions.

Staying warm

It's not only the occupants who will feel the chill on icy mornings. A cold engine should be allowed to warm up on idle for a minute or two before pulling away, so that the oil has had a chance to reach those parts of the engine where it's most needed.

For warmth on the inside, you and your passengers will appreciate a heating system that's working properly. This is not only for the comfort of passengers, of course, since an effective heater and defroster is important for keeping the windows free from misting up and icing over again, thus ensuring that good visibility is maintained at all times.

Anti-freeze

Since it's winter time it probably shouldn't need saying, but it's surprising how many people fail to check whether the anti-freeze is at the correct concentration. It's unlikely these days that the engine will become frozen solid, but the correct amount of anti-freeze actually helps to keep the engine running at the correct temperature and helps to protect the engine when it needs to be started from an especially icy start.

Winter car maintenance

As you can see, routine winter car maintenance needn't be time consuming or expensive. It doesn't require a major overhaul, but rather, regular attention to a handful of otherwise minor details. A little attention could make the world of difference between a vehicle that's safe to drive in all that the winter might throw at us, and one that's not.

The Twenty Fastest Muscle Cars

From the mid to early 1970's a new breed of cars ruled the American streets. The majority of these were intermediate sized automobiles with large block engines stuffed inside. At first these cars were called "super cars" and over time they became know more accurately as muscle cars. The quarter mile was the performance standard and weekend drag racing became very popular.

Many of these cars pulled weekday duty as commuter vehicles, taking their proud owners to work and school. But, on the weekend the guys at the wheel were full fledged "amateur" dragsters. For the first time (and many would argue the only time) in American automotive history, high performance vehicles were available to the masses. The average Joe with a decent job could go to his local dealership and drive away with a ground pounding, tire smoking muscle car. Additionally, in a time before complicated emission controls and computer chips, an average Joe could actually working on his pride.

As the list of the twenty fastest muscle cars points out, the majority of the beasts had domesticated roots. The Road Runners, Chevelles and Chargers were all basic family cruisers. What made them special was those wonderfully powerful big block engines. Even the Camaros and 'Cudas were decent transportation for the young man with a couple of small children. Only the Corvettes and the Cobra were initially created as sports cars.

As everyone over this generation knows, the muscle car became extinct in the early 1970's. Rising fuel costs, rising insurance premiums and new safety concerns marked the end of this era. Today the original muscle cars are one of the hottest automotive collectables. Men of a certain age are aggressively bidding for the car of their youthful dreams.

So take a look at the list and see who really owned the streets when muscle cars reigned supreme. For more information about all the great Muscle Cars of the past visit Muscle Car Facts.

Rank - Model - - Mile Time and Speed - - Engine - - HP - - TRANS - - Source

1 - 1966 427 Cobra - - 12.20 sec @ 118 mph - - 427 8V - - 425 - - 4-Speed - - CAR CRAFT 11/65

2 - 1966 Corvette 427 - - 12.80 sec @ 112 mph - - L72 427 - - 425 - - 4-Speed - - CAR AND DRIVER 11/65

3 - 1969 Road Runner - - 12.91 sec @ 111 mph - - 440 Six BBL - 390 - - 4-Speed - - SUPER STOCK 6/69

4 - 1970 Hemi Cuda - - 13.10 sec @ 107 mph - - 426 Hemi - 425 - 4-Speed - CAR CRAFT 11/69

5 - 1970 Chevelle SS 454 - - 13.12 sec @ 107 mph - - 454 LS6 - 450 - - 4-Speed - - CAR CRAFT 11/69

6 - 1969 Camaro - - - 13.16 sec @ 110 mph - - 427 ZL1 - - 430 - - 4-Speed - - HI PERFORMANCE 6/69

7 - 1968 Corvette - - - 13.30 sec @ 108 mph - - 427 6V - - 435 - - 4-Speed - - HI PERFORMANCE 5/68

8 - 1970 Road Runner - - 13.34 sec @ 107 mph - - 426 Hemi - - 425 - - automatic - - SUPER STOCK 12/69

9 - 1970 Buick GS Stage I - - 13.38 sec @ 105 mph - - 455 Stage I - - 360 - automatic - - MOTOR TREND 1/70

10 - 1968 Corvette 427 - - 13.41 sec @ 109 mph - - L72 427 - - 425 - - 4-Speed - - CAR AND DRIVER 6/68

11 - 1969 Charger 500 - - 13.48 sec @ 109 mph - - 426 Hemi - - 425 - - 4-Speed - - HOT ROD 2/69

12 - 1968 Charger - - - 13.50 sec @ 105 mph - - 426 Hemi - 425 - - automatic - - CAR AND DRIVER 11/67

13 - 1970 Plymouth Superbird - 13.50 sec @ 105 mph - - 426 Hemi - - 425

14 - 1968 Road Runner - - 13.54 sec @ 105 mph - - 426 Hemi - - 425 - - automatic - - CAR AND DRIVER 1/69

15 - 1973 Trans Am - - 13.54 sec @ 104 mph - - 455 SD - - 310 - - automatic - - HOT ROD 6/73

16 - 1969 Corvette - - - 13.56 sec @ 111 mph - - 427 L88 - - 430 - - automatic - - HOT ROD 4/69

17 - 1969 Super Bee - - 13.56 sec @ 105 mph - - 440 Six Pack - - 390 - - automatic - - HOT ROD 8/69

18 - 1969 Boss 429 Mustang - 13.60 sec @ 106 mph - - Boss 429 - - 375 - - 4-Speed - - HI PERFORMANCE 9/69

19 - 1970 Challenger R/T - - 13.62 sec @ 104 mph - - 440 Six Pack - - 390 - - automatic - - CAR CRAFT 11/69

20 - 1970 Torino Cobra - - 13.63 sec @ 105 mph - - 429 SCJ - - 370 - - automatic - - SUPER STOCK 3/70

Another Movie Car

Judge Dredd was one of Sylvester Stallone's films however not one of his most successful ones. According to some of the critics, the props were the stars of the show and one of these was a customized Land Rover.

The year is 2139 and the setting is Mega City (our present New York City). American society has deteriorated into a state of barbarianism. Violence is the order of the day. Neighborhoods engage in gang wars and are patrolled by street judges who are combination judges, juries and executioners. However, New York, today or in the future, would not be New York without a taxi service. Enter the taxis of the future, the 'city cabs.'

According to the specifications, the vehicles had to accommodate six passengers in a maximum protective environment. So, as one might imagine, the vehicle resembled a tank mounted on wheels with rubber tires.

It was a right hand drive vehicle with two tiny windows in the front. There were no back or side windows. Therefore, in order to drive the vehicle, a driver and a navigator were needed. The driver controlled the vehicle from behind the wheel while the navigator watched for traffic. In order to see through the windshield, the driver had to tilt his head from side to side while leaning forward.

To get into the vehicle, one had to step up on the front tire and crawl inside without falling.

In 2139 Land Rovers are the world's only vehicles. So the 'city cabs' were custom built on a Land Rover 101 Forward Control chassis. The green oval logo is visible on the front.

The Land Rover 101 Forward Control had originally been built for the British Army to tow a L118 field gun together with a ton of ammunition and other equipment. It also had to be easy to transport by air.

Consequently, the engine was placed under and to the rear of the cab and the front hood was eliminated. This resulted in a cube shape, which made it space efficient during air transport. This basic shape also contributed to the futuristic appearance of the 'city cabs.' Other 'futuristic' features are the large wheels and tires. There is a 'wheel step' for the crew to use to enter the vehicle.

At the time the film was conceived, Land Rover had a designer, David Woodhouse, who had experimented with work on futuristic Land Rovers and already had some ideas to use for the 'city cabs.' So Land Rover's design team, led by Gordon Sked, submitted their ideas to the producers and Land Rover was awarded the contract to produce thirty-one vehicles

They modified the 101's by removing the body and replacing it with a fiberglass body equipped with the small windows in the front and the one small fiberglass door. To emphasize the cuboid appearance all rounded edges or panels were eliminated. The wheels were also extended ten inches. All of these modifications combined provided the aggressive, futuristic look that the vehicles displayed in the film.

There are still several of these vehicles in existence. While not easy to drive, they are in drivable condition and often turn up at Land Rover events.

Car Fuses and Fuse Holders

In most electronics in the vehicles that we drive today has fuses of some size. There are fuses that are in the fuse panel that can either take a glass fuses or blade fuses. These can range from .5 amps up to 30 amps. These run all the electronics in the cars panel like the lights in the dash and things like that. The problem comes from when you have to figure out which one is blown. The easiest way to do this is with a test light. This will tell you which one is blown with out having to take out every one of them. There are certain cars that take different fuses like the European cars but those fuses are not very popular.

Then there are other types of fuses that are used by people that install car audio. In this profession they use one of three different types of fuses and fuse holders. There is the ANL fuses and the ANL fuse holders. These look like big Blade fuses. You can find them from the size of 100 amps to 300 amps for car amplifiers. They are used to keep things from overloading and catching the car on fire. If a fuse blows then you will have to get it checked out. Do not just replace with a bigger fuse. This will be a bad thing to do since it can cause a fire or burn up the electronics in your car. Also there are the AGU fuses that range in sizes from 30 amps to 80 amps. These are popular for some of the small to medium systems. They look like a big glass fuse and they have there own types of fuse holders also. The last type of fuses they use are the Maxi fuses. These are also available in sizes of 30-80 amps.

So as you can see there are a lot of different types and sizes of fuses and fuse holders.

General Information For Prospective Bidders at a Used Car Auction

Have you ever wondered about those ads you see for a used car auction? If you've ever wondered about attending one of these events in the UK, here's some information you might find useful.

Deciphering the Catalog

When you attend a used automobile auction, you'll be given a catalog that contains extensive information about the cars being offered. The information in the catalog ranks second in importance to a thorough inspection of the vehicles themselves. Since auctions have a language all their own, here's a quick rundown on some of the terms you might find in the catalog of a used auto auction.

"Reserve" is the minimum a seller will accept for his car. Bidding begins in the car auction at the amount.

"Without reserve" means that the bidding at a used vehicle auction starts with whatever amount the first bidder bids.

"As seen" means that the car is sold at a vehicle auction just as it is. It may have faults and flaws that are not disclosed.

"All good" means that all that the major components of the vehicle are sound. This includes items like the engine and transmission, steering, brakes, etc. Minor components like tires and instruments might be damaged or not functioning. A used auto auction may offer a warranty to cover an "all good" vehicle.

"Warranted all good" means that the used car for auction has a known service history and has no major mechanical faults. This is a kind of guarantee that allows a successful bidder to reject the car if substantial problems with engine or drive train are discovered.

"Specified faults" means that vehicles at public auto auctions have documented problems. The wording of the description of the faults can be deceptive. For example, "minor engine noise" could mean anything from a squeaky fan belt to serious engine damage like a broken rod.

The catalog at a UK used car auction merits some serious study if you intend to be both a knowledgeable and successful bidder.

Car Total Loss - Determining And Settling The Value Of Your Car!

What is the car total loss process? Once you are in an
accident, the insurance company must inspect the vehicle and determine whether
the damage was substantial enough to declare a complete loss.

Most insurance companies will want to inspect the vehicles
themselves. In most accidents, insurance companies have approved body shops
write estimates and they eventually issue payment based on that estimate.
However, when there is a potential for a car total loss, most insurance
companies want their insurance adjuster to inspect the vehicle.

The reason for this is the conflict of interest that arises
from the arrangement between the insurance company and the body shop. Body shops
are in the business of fixing cars. They have a vested interest in quoting the
repairs so the car can be fixed and not declare it a car total loss.

For all practical purposes this means that you will be
waiting longer. Usually it takes two to three business days for the body shop to
issue a repair estimate. If the claim adjuster or the field representative has
to inspect and write their own estimate, then you will be waiting three to five
more days to get to the location of your car.

Before the adjuster comes out, she/he will submit all
pertinent information about your car (year, make, model, and mileage) to a third
party company. This company usually is CCC
Information Services Group, Inc.
CCC will do a preliminary report to
determine what the value of your car is so the adjuster knows what the insurance
company would be looking to if there is a total loss.

Depending on your state law and the specific insurance
company, there will be a car total loss when the insurance company believes that
the cost to fix the car reaches 70%, 80%, or even 90% of its total value. It is
always a good idea to ask the adjuster what is the threshold they use to
determine a total loss.

When the vehicle is being estimated by the car total loss
adjuster, this individual will be looking at the condition of the vehicle. They
will note how clean the vehicle is, what is the exact mileage, and what
equipment and options the car has. All of this information will be reflected in
the final evaluation of the vehicle.

The adjuster will then submit the inspection report again
to CCC. CCC will send a final report showing comparative prices for the vehicles
in your local market. They will establish what the fair market value of the car
is and what a fair offer of settlement would be. For more information on how to
dispute this report visit:
http://www.auto-insurance-claim-advice.com/car-total-loss-2.html.

Next, the adjuster must determine who the lien holder of
the vehicle is. If you have a car loan, the insurance adjuster must get that
information so they can contact the bank to determine how much is owed. There
are different requirements insurance companies must follow. If the insurance
company you are dealing with is your own (you are claiming the car total loss
against your own insurance company) then they will be bound by the terms of the
policy, which 99% of the time requires them to pay the bank first. If you are
making a total loss against someone elses insurance company (the person that
hit you), then this requirement does not exist (there is no actual policy to be
bound by).

If you have a loan, then the insurance adjuster will
request from the bank a Letter of Guarantee. This letter is an agreement between
the bank and the insurance company that for the payment of x amount, the bank
will release the title of the car to the insurance company directly. This
process usually takes four to five days.

If the amount you owe for the car is less than what the
insurance company will pay for the car total loss, then the insurance company
will pay the loan amount and then issue you a second check directly. If the loan
amount is higher than what the car total loss offer, then you will be upside
down your loan. You will be required to continue making payments even though the
car title will be transferred to the insurance company.

Once you receive payment for your loss, you will be able to
go out and get another car. For more information the total loss process and how
to protect your interest, visit:

Pedal Car Restoration

Restoring a vintage pedal car is a great way to bring your stylish collectible back to its former glory. It is a time consuming, yet very rewarding, process. Restoration can mean everything from replacing a missing hubcap to completely overhauling the entire car. This, of course, will depend on the original condition, and your goals. Here's a guide to restoration for collectors of these wonderful toys.

First, find a pedal car to restore. Of course, you can restore your own childhood plaything. Restoring your childhood toy can be a great way to preserve fond memories. However, you can also purchase a vintage original specifically to restore. If you are purchasing a vintage car, look for a few things that will make your restoration job easier. If the body is straight with no damage, this will save you a lot of work. Consider the amount of restoration needed when buying a project car.

Then, carefully evaluate the condition of your pedal car. Look for areas that are worn or damaged. You should disassemble the car completely so that you can examine the interior parts as well. Make sure that you do not damage any nuts, bolts, or other mounting hardware in the process of disassembling the car.

Pedal car restoration for collectors can range from very simple projects to an elaborate undertaking. If your car is in relatively good condition, you may simply need to do a little work to preserve it. If your car only needs thorough cleaning and minor repairs, your work will be quite simple. Clean each part, make any necessary repairs, and then reassemble your project. However, if your car has rusted spots, worn paint, and missing pieces, you will have quite a lot of work ahead of you if you want to perform a full restoration.

Now, find any parts that you need to make your project car complete. It will be quite difficult to find the missing pieces of some models although if you're lucky, yours will be one of the more popular ones, and spare parts will be available. There are several online vendors of reproduction parts, or you may be able to find a part from a pedal car that is otherwise in poor condition. If all else fails, you may be able to craft a replacement.

Finally, prepare the car to be rebuilt. Strip and sand old paint and rust from the body, remove dents, weld cracks and holes, and repair rusted areas. Then send it out to be repainted inside and out, and send accessory parts to be chrome plated. Finally, install any replacement parts you have ordered, and put the pedal car back together. Be sure to fit it together once before the final assembly, to make sure that all of the parts will fit together correctly.

Pedal car restoration involves everything from replacing missing parts to refinishing the chassis or overhauling the drive mechanism. However, try to keep as much of the original equipment as possible, as this will add to the value of the finished result. Restoration is a balance of preserving the original pedal car and improving its display value. Restoring your dream collectible can be very rewarding as you watch it turn from a rusty old car to a beautiful, shiny pedal car worthy of display.
